San Miguel, TNT in semis

July 28, 2022 Robert Andaya 444 views

SAN Miguel Beer and TNT Tropang Giga fashioned out similar easy victories over their respective quarterfinal opponents in the PBA Philippine Cup at the Smart Araneta Coliseum.

San Miguel slammed the door on Blackwater Bossing, 123-93, while TNT finished off Converge FiberX, 116-95, to advance to the semis.

Marcio Lassiter and CJ Perez finished with 18 points apiece as the Beermen made short work of the Bossing in their No.1 versus No. 8 quarterfinal duel.

Jericho Cruz added 17 points 12 of them in the first half; Mo Tautuaa and Vic Manuel contributed 12 points each and June Mar Fajardo and Simon Enciso had 11 each in a balanced display of firepower.

“Our target at the start of the tourney was the Top 2. In the quarters, we don’t want a second game because we want time yo prepare for the semis,” said San Miguel coach Leo Austria.

Up next for San Miguel in the semis is the winner between Meralco and Barangay Ginebra.

The Bolts lead the best-of-three series, 1-0.

Five players, led by Mikey Williams and Troy Rosario, scored in double figures for the Tropang Giga, who led by as many as 33 points enroute to a lopsided victory over the FiberXers.

Williams, who leads the league in scoring with an average of 21.7 points a game, finished with 26 points on 7-of-13 shooting in less than 30 minutes of action.

The 30-year-old sophomore guard also went 4-of-7 from the three-point zone to power TNT to a semifinals appearance against either Magnolia Chicken Timplados or NLEX.

Rosario added 18 points and seven rebounds, followed by Roger Pogoy with 16 points, Jayson Castro with15 points and Kelly Williams with10.

Tyrus Hills carried the fight for Converge wirh 18 markers.

Michael Digregorio added 14 points, Abu Tratter had a double double of 10 points and 11 rebounds and Maverick Ahanmisi had 10 points and eight boards.

Meanwhile, Mark Barroca of Magnolia was voted as the Cignal Play-PBA Press Corps Player of the Week for the period July 20-24.

Barroca, the 36-year-old former Far Eastern University standout, finished with averages of 13.3 points ,4.7 rebounds, 4.7 assists, and 3.0 steals in three games.

The Zamboanga City native also became the 94th player in PBA history to join the elite 5,000-Point Club. He also became only the eighth player in Magnolia franchise history to mark the milestone.
